A Simple Loaf, A Powerful Impact

By Hasan sadk | Project leader

Dear Donor

During one of our recent visits to distribute bread in a camp in the village of Kafra in northern Syria, we met a family living in very difficult conditions. This family consists of three sons: Bilal, Daoud, and Zakaria, in addition to two daughters and their mother. The children are between 4 and 12 years old, and have been living in a small tent since they lost their father a year and a half ago to cancer..

When we distributed the bread, we were met with indescribable joy from the children; their faces lit up with smiles as if they were celebrating a special holiday. This moment served as a powerful reminder of the importance of our work. In the world of these children, these simple loaves meant much more than just food—they symbolized hope, security, and the knowledge that someone cares about them..

Their mother, who bears the responsibility of raising the children alone, works tirelessly in fruit and vegetable picking alongside her eldest daughter, Zainab, who is 12 years old. Despite all the efforts made by the mother and Zainab, their income barely covers the family’s basic needs. They live under conditions that lack the most basic necessities, suffering from a lack of resources and support..
